Which of the following bodys of water is bound on three sides by Australia  north by the erasure sea
kipiarov [429]

<span>The Gulf of Carpentaria which is a body of water bounded on three sides by Australia and to the north by the Arafura Sea. It is a large, shallow sea. To the west of the Gulf of Carpentaria is Arnhem Land, to the east is the Cape York Peninsula and to the south lies the Gulf Country. The first European explorer to have touched the region was Willem Janszoon, who was a Dutch navigator and the first European to see the Australian coast.<span>

Which statement describes surface waves? They arrive before S waves. They travel faster than P waves. They are produced by P and
kramer

Answer:

Seismic waves are fundamentally of two types, compressional, longitudinal waves or shear, transverse waves. Through the body of the Earth these are called P-waves (for primary because they are fastest) and S-waves (for secondary since they are slower).
